Имеем кривое письмо, в котором в заголовке описан прикрепленный файл, а далее в теле письма идет сам файл, без всяких описаний что это, т.е. просто результат кодирования в base64 (uuencode -m без начала и конца). Сам почтовик при отображении письма показывает что вложение есть, но открыть/сохранить его не может. Если поможет, то вот часть заголовка, вроде все нормально: ---- Content-class: urn:content-classes:message MIME-Version: 1.0 Content-Type: application/msword; name="Secret_.doc" Content-Transfer-Encoding: base64 Content-Description: Secret_.doc Content-Disposition: attachment; filename="Secret_.doc" ---- После заголовка пустая строка и далее сам base64. Если сохранить письмо полностью, то munpack этот атач выдергивает. При добавление в начало "begin-base64 644 Secret_.doc" и в конец "====", тогда и uudecode кушает. PS: что самое интересное, пока тыкал по письмам, и в некоторый момент на это письмо: все распозналось... Возможно после двойного шелчка на нем, когда он открывается в отдельном окне, ибо тогда этот атач смог открываться.
Сейчас, вроде, всё работает. Сейчас посмотрел некоторое количество писем с аттачами, все открываются нормально. Закрываю ошибку.
Если встретится, переоткрою.